IT'S been one of the most talked about Coronation Street storylines in recent years. And now, the mystery of what has happened to troubled teen Lauren Bolton – which has gripped fans of the soap for months – is finally going to be solved. So, who better than Lucy Fallon , who plays the cobbles’ resident journalist and self-appointed detective Bethany Platt , to dish the dirt on what viewers can expect – including the fact that Lauren isn’t dead? “Bethany’s been desperate to pin Lauren’s disappearance on Nathan [Curtis, who groomed her],” Lucy, 28, explains.

“She wants him to go back to prison , so she wants it to be him. But obviously, he hasn’t killed Lauren. "She is actually alive.

It’s going to really throw Bethany when she finds out. It will all be very triggering for her.” The high-profile plot is what enticed Lucy back to the show.

She previously quit Weatherfield in 2020 after five years, but returned last year as the writers thought Bethany was crucial to telling the story. “I am so relieved they didn’t kill me off as I might not be sat here right now. Thanks, guys!” she says, laughing.

“I got the phone call from a producer last April who said: ‘Something is going to happen. Somebody on the Street is getting groomed. And that’s what’s going to bring you back into the story.

’ “I needed that time away. I didn’t go and do an awful lot of work stuff. But I feel like I did quite a lot of life stuff.
